Launched in 1997, this scheme aims to ensure financial support for daughters from birth to their education. Under the scheme, mothers receive a financial assistance of ₹500 upon the birth of a daughter. Subsequent financial assistance is provided to daughters at various stages of their education, from grade 1 to grade 10. The scheme is available only to BPL families in urban and rural areas, and only two daughters in a family are permitted to benefit from it.

Benefits at the Birth of a Daughter

Mothers receive financial assistance of ₹500 upon the birth of a daughter. Subsequently, annual assistance is provided at different levels of education. ₹300 is provided for classes 1 to 3, ₹500 for class 4, ₹600 for class 5, ₹700 for classes 6 and 7, ₹800 for class 8, and ₹1000 for classes 9 and 10.

Required Documents

Several documents are required to avail benefits under the scheme, including the daughter’s Aadhaar card, birth certificate, parents’ Aadhaar cards, ration card, residence certificate, passport-size photo, income certificate, and bank passbook details.

Who can apply?

This scheme can be availed by daughters from BPL families who are under 18 years of age and have their daughter’s birth certificate.

Application forms can be obtained from the nearest Anganwadi center, Block Development Office, or Women and Child Development Department. The application must then be submitted along with the required documents.
